C# .NET SDK para renderizar e visualizar documentos

API REST para criar aplicativos .NET de visualizador de documento integrado. Renderize com precisão uma ampla variedade de formatos de arquivo como imagens, HTML ou PDF.

  • GroupDocs.Viewer Cloud SDK for cURL
  • GroupDocs.Viewer Cloud SDK for Java
  • GroupDocs.Viewer Cloud SDK for PHP
  • GroupDocs.Viewer Cloud SDK for Python
  • GroupDocs.Viewer Cloud SDK for Ruby
  • GroupDocs.Viewer Cloud SDK for Node.js
  • GroupDocs.Viewer Cloud SDK for Android
Iniciar teste gratuito

GroupDocs.Viewer SDK para .NET foi desenvolvido para ajudá-lo a começar rapidamente com nossa API de nuvem do visualizador de documentos. O SDK ajuda fornecendo um nível mais alto de abstração para que você não precise saber os detalhes relativos ao tratamento das solicitações e respostas HTTP das APIs REST.

Usando o .NET SDK, você pode utilizar todos os recursos da API e aprimorar seu aplicativo com a capacidade de renderizar uma variedade de formatos de documentos padrão do setor. O SDK permite visualizar um documento específico em HTML, imagem, PDF ou seu formato original com a flexibilidade de renderizar o documento inteiro, página por página ou faixa personalizada de páginas.

Como visualizar um arquivo em Java

  • Crie uma instância de Configuration usando Client Id e Client Secret disponíveis.
  • Crie uma instância de Configuration usando a instância de Configuration.
  • Crie uma instância de FileInfo e defina o caminho para o arquivo de entrada usando a propriedade FileInfo.FilePath.
  • Crie uma instância de ViewOptions e use a propriedade FilePath para definir a instância de FileInfo.
  • Use ViewApi.CreateView() para renderizar o arquivo de entrada em imagens e HTML.

perguntas frequentes

Eu quero criar meu próprio aplicativo .NET para visualizar documentos?

Confira GroupDocs.Viewer Cloud SDK para .NET no GitHub se estiver procurando o código-fonte para visualizar o arquivo no Nuvem.

Posso experimentar as APIs REST do GroupDocs.Viewer no .NET gratuitamente?

Você pode experimentar o GroupDocs.Viewer APIs .NET de baixo código sem quaisquer limitações.

Eu não quero carregar meus arquivos confidenciais em qualquer lugar? Quais são minhas opções?

GroupDocs.Viewer Cloud também está disponível como imagem Docker que pode ser usada para auto-hospedar o serviço. Ou você pode criar seus próprios serviços usando GroupDocs.Viewer High-code APIs que atualmente orientam nossas APIs REST.

Recursos avançados da API REST do visualizador de documentos

Renderizar documentos como HTML5

Renderizar documentos como imagem

Girar, reordenar e marcar páginas com marca d’água

Renderizar documentos como PDF

Processar anexos de documentos

As APIs são protegidas e requerem autenticação

Renderização de documentos

Renderize e exiba vários formatos de documento em aplicativos .NET.

Opções de visualização de documentos

Escolha entre várias opções de visualização, incluindo documentos inteiros, páginas específicas ou intervalos de páginas personalizados.

Formatos de saída

Visualize documentos nos formatos HTML, imagem (JPEG, PNG, TIFF) ou PDF.

Integração Simplificada

Incorpore facilmente recursos de visualização de documentos em aplicativos .NET.

Personalização do visualizador

Personalize as configurações do visualizador, como níveis de zoom, rotação e seleção de texto.

Extração de metadados

Extraia os metadados do documento, incluindo propriedades, contagem de páginas e tamanho do arquivo.

Marca d’água e anotações

Adicione marcas d’água a documentos e anote-os com comentários de texto, destaques e formas.

Comunicação segura

Garanta a comunicação segura entre o aplicativo .NET e a API GroupDocs.Viewer Cloud.

Cache eficiente

Utilize um mecanismo de cache eficiente para otimizar o desempenho da renderização.

Alta disponibilidade

Beneficie-se da alta disponibilidade e confiabilidade do GroupDocs.Viewer Cloud para .NET.

Um SDK fácil para desenvolvedores que desejam economizar tempo

Usar as APIs do GroupDocs Cloud é bastante simples, pois não há nada para instalar. Basta criar uma conta no GroupDocs Cloud e obter as informações do seu aplicativo. Assim que tiver o SID e a chave do aplicativo, você estará pronto para experimentar as APIs REST do GroupDocs Cloud. Os SDKs foram desenvolvidos para facilitar os desenvolvedores e permitir que eles comecem a usar nossas APIs rapidamente.

Explore as opções para apresentação de documentos

A API do visualizador baseado em nuvem tem a capacidade de exibir diferentes formatos de documento rapidamente, com apenas algumas linhas de código. Usando o SDK para .NET, você pode usar todos esses recursos da API e renderizar documentos como PDF, HTML ou imagens.

Renderize o documento com opções de visualização HTML - C#

//Obtenha seu App SID, App Key e Storage Name em https://dashboard.groupdocs.cloud (registro gratuito é necessário).
  var configuração = nova configuração(appSID, appKey);
  var apiInstance = new ViewerApi(configuração);
  var viewOptions = new ViewOptions()
  {
      ArquivoInfo = new ArquivoInfo()
      {
          FilePath = "documentos/doc.dwf",
          Senha = "",
          StorageName = "Nome do armazenamento"
      },
      RenderOptions = new HtmlOptions()
      {
          Recursos Externos = verdadeiro
      }
  };
  var request = new CreateViewRequest(viewOptions);
  var resposta = apiInstance.CreateView(pedido

Prestação Flexível de Documentos

GroupDocs.Viewer é um poderoso visualizador de documentos REST API que permite exibir vários formatos de documentos em seus aplicativos. Ele permite a renderização de documentos para todo o documento, página por página ou intervalo personalizado de páginas.

Segurança e Autenticação

A API GroupDocs.Viewer Cloud é segura e requer autenticação. Os usuários precisam se registrar no GroupDocs Cloud e obter o App SID e a App Key. As solicitações de autenticação exigem uma assinatura e parâmetros de consulta AppSID ou cabeçalho de autorização OAuth 2.0.

Visualizar documentos usando o aplicativo gratuito GroupDocs.Viewer

ZIPDOTXPSM1DIBJPMOTPOTSMDRTFHPGVSXJSVSDPSXLTXEMLXJPFOSTDIFFVBOBJJ2CMHTMLXPSMAKELOGJPGXLAMPPSXPPSFODGVSSMXZGZJLSPCLCPPJPEGPLWMZXLSBTGZVSDXSASSHTMODSHAMLDWFMCDR7ZOTTAS3IGSMBOXODTMOBIERBJSONCMXEMFPOTTEXYAMLDOCXPPTEPUBVSTPNGWMFCXXVCFGZIPXLSAISQLCHMNSFIFCDWGSCRIPTASMMLDOTMHJPXEMZSVGGROOVYTAR.GZJPCXLSXCSVSTXLESSSCALAMMAPNGTIFFSCMOXPSPHPMPXPSBXLSMPPTXDGNDXFTARCSVRSTCXLTJP2TGAVSSXTIFTXTCCDOCMXMLPPSMMPPPPTMFODPFODSBZ2XMLPROPERTIESVIMMSGPOTMSHPDFBMPBATDJVUICOPYSVGZPOTXEPSXLTMMPTJ2KVSDMCF2DCMPSDONEODGVDWHHEMLSMLTSVDOTRBCGMTAR.XZVDXASRARPSD1SXCVTXCSSPSTPLTPS1MHTVSSJAVASTLHTMLCMAKEDNGTXZVSTMWEBPODPGIFOTGDOCNUMBERSDWT

Recursos de suporte e aprendizado

GroupDocs.Viewer Cloud também oferece SDKs de renderização de documentos individuais para outras linguagens populares, conforme listado abaixo:

  Português